The An Act for the Suppression of Trade in, and Circulation of, Obscene Literature and Articles of Immoral Use (Comstock Act) legislation of 1873 made it illegal to possess or create erotica within the U.S., criminalizing the distribution of “obscene, lewd, or lascivious” materials, including not only pornography, but also contraceptives, sex toys, and information related to abortion and/or birth control which was enshrined under U.S. federal law enforced via the postal system...
